<?php /* # ---------------------------------------------------------------------- # SIZE GROUP - DETAILS: CONTROL # ---------------------------------------------------------------------- */ $_get = new SIZE_GET(); $_update = new SIZE_UPDATE(); $req_size_id = filter_var($_REQUEST['size_id'], FILTER_SANITIZE_STRING); $req_size_name = filter_var($_REQUEST['size_name'], FILTER_SANITIZE_STRING); $detail_size = $_get->get_detail($req_size_id); $size = $_get->get_detail_size($detail_size->size_type_id); $sku = $_get->get_detail_size($detail_size->size_type_id); if (isset($_POST['btn-detail-size'])) { $size_type_name = filter_var($_POST['name'], FILTER_SANITIZE_STRING); $size_type_id = $detail_size->size_type_id; $max_type_order = $_get->get_order(); $size_type_order = $detail_size->size_type_order; $size_type_active = 'Active'; $size_type_visibility = filter_var($_POST['visibility'], FILTER_SANITIZE_STRING); $size_name_array = filter_var($_POST['size'], FILTER_SANITIZE_STRING); $size_name = array(); $size_name = explode(",", $size_name_array); $size_sku_array = filter_var($_POST['sku'], FILTER_SANITIZE_STRING); $size_sku = array(); $size_sku = explode(",", $size_sku_array); $check = $_get->count_products($size_type_id); $check_name = $_get->count_name($size_type_name, $detail_size->size_type_id); if ($_POST['btn-detail-size'] != 'Delete') { if ($check_name->rows > 0) {
<?php /* # ---------------------------------------------------------------------- # SIZE GROUP - ADD: CONTROL # ---------------------------------------------------------------------- */ $_get = new SIZE_GET(); $_update = new SIZE_UPDATE(); if (isset($_POST['btn_add_size']) && $_POST['btn_add_size'] == 'Save Changes') { $size_type_name = filter_var($_POST['name'], FILTER_SANITIZE_STRING); $max_type_order = $_get->get_order(); $size_type_order = $max_type_order->max_order * 1 + 1; $size_type_active = 'Active'; $size_type_visibility = filter_var($_POST['visibility'], FILTER_SANITIZE_STRING); $size_name_array = filter_var($_POST['size'], FILTER_SANITIZE_STRING); $size_name = array(); $size_name = explode(",", $size_name_array); $size_sku_array = filter_var($_POST['sku'], FILTER_SANITIZE_STRING); $size_sku = array(); $size_sku = explode(",", $size_sku_array); $check = $_get->count_products($size_type_name); if ($check->rows > 0) { $type = 'danger'; $msg = $size_type_name . ' has already taken, please input another size group name'; } else { $_update->insert($size_type_name, $size_type_order, $size_type_active, $size_type_visibility, $size_sku, $size_name); $type = 'success'; $msg = 'Item(s) has been successfully saved'; } $page = 'add-size';
<?php /* # ---------------------------------------------------------------------- # SIZE GROUP: CONTROL # ---------------------------------------------------------------------- */ $_get = new SIZE_GET(); $_update = new SIZE_UPDATE(); /* # ---------------------------------------------------------------------- # SORTING # ---------------------------------------------------------------------- */ $equal_search = array('size_type_active', 'size_type_visibility'); $default_sort_by = "size_type_name"; $pgdata = page_init($equal_search, $default_sort_by); // static/general.php $page = $pgdata['page']; $query_per_page = $pgdata['query_per_page']; $sort_by = $pgdata['sort_by']; $first_record = $pgdata['first_record']; $search_parameter = $pgdata['search_parameter']; $search_value = $pgdata['search_value']; $search_query = $pgdata['search_query']; $search = $pgdata['search']; if (isset($_REQUEST['src'])) { $_REQUEST['src'] = $_REQUEST['src']; } else { $_REQUEST['src'] = ''; }